The 3RT841B is a specialized wireless communication module frequently used in industrial automation, IoT gateways, and long-range data transmission systems. Keeping the 3RT841B firmware updated is critical for maintaining link stability, ensuring data security, and unlocking newer protocol features.
This guide covers everything you need to know about locating, installing, and troubleshooting firmware for this hardware. ⚡ Why Firmware Updates Matter
Updating your 3RT841B isn't just about "new features." It is a vital maintenance step for several reasons:
Network Stability: Fixes intermittent packet loss and connection drops.
Security Patches: Protects your hardware from known vulnerabilities in wireless protocols.
Protocol Support: Newer firmware often adds support for updated MQTT or Modbus versions.
Hardware Efficiency: Optimizes power consumption for battery-operated remote nodes. 🔍 How to Identify Your Current Version
Before searching for a download, you must verify your current build. Most 3RT841B modules provide this info via:
AT Commands: Connect via Serial/TTL and send AT+GMR or AT+VERSION.
Web Interface: If the module is part of a gateway, check the "System Information" tab.
Physical Label: Some modules ship with a "Stock Firmware" version printed on the shielding. 📥 Finding the Right 3RT841B Firmware

Most 3RT841B modules are flashed using a USB-to-TTL adapter (like a CP2102 or FTDI chip). 1. Preparation Backup: Save your current configuration settings.
Power: Ensure a stable 3.3V or 5V power supply (refer to your specific data sheet).
Tools: Download a flashing tool such as STM32CubeProgrammer, QFlash, or a generic ESPTool depending on the underlying chipset. 2. Connection Logic Connect your TTL adapter to the module pins: TX → RX RX → TX GND → GND
Boot Pin: Some modules require pulling a specific GPIO pin to Ground to enter "Download Mode." 3. The Flashing Process Open your flashing software. Select the correct COM Port. Load the 3RT841B firmware file. Set the Baud Rate (typically 115200). Click Start/Write and wait for the "Success" prompt. ⚠️ Troubleshooting Common Issues
"Failed to Connect": Check your TX/RX wiring. Swap them and try again.
"Checksum Error": The download might be corrupted. Re-download the firmware file. 3rt841b firmware
Boot Loop: This usually happens if the firmware version doesn't match the hardware revision. You will need to flash the "Stock" version to recover.
📌 Pro Tip: Always perform a Factory Reset (AT+RESTORE) after a major firmware jump to ensure old configuration fragments don't cause crashes.

The is a popular "three-in-one" smart Android LED TV motherboard commonly used in brands like Lloyd, TCL, and other universal TV chassis. Maintaining current firmware on this board is essential for resolving common display faults, such as blurred or black screens, flickering, and system lag. Why Firmware Updates Matter
Updating the firmware for a 3RT841B-based TV modifies the embedded software that controls the hardware. This process can:
Fix Software Glitches: Resolve issues like "logo hang" (stuck on the boot screen) or "no display" faults.
Enhance Performance: Improve system response speed, image processing, and decoding abilities.
Update Security: Patch vulnerabilities and ensure compatibility with newer streaming applications and network protocols. How to Update 3RT841B Firmware

is a common "three-in-one" TV motherboard used in various 32" to 42" LED TV models. Firmware Review: Performance & Reliability
The firmware for the 3RT841B is generally regarded as a "stable but static" operating environment. It is designed for efficiency rather than feature richness. Stability:
The software is highly reliable for core TV functions. According to AliExpress technical resources
, it handles standard signal processing well, though it lacks the advanced "Smart TV" bells and whistles found in high-end sets. Update Process:
A significant drawback is the lack of Over-the-Air (OTA) updates. Users must manually flash firmware using USB drives or EEPROM programmers like the
, which makes it less user-friendly for non-technical owners. Visual Performance:
When paired with compatible panels, the firmware supports clear 1080p output. However, hardware issues like degraded capacitors can lead to visual artifacts that the firmware cannot compensate for. Compatibility:
It is widely used in budget models (e.g., TH-42JS650DX), making replacement firmware relatively easy to find on technician forums, though you must ensure the panel resolution in the software matches your physical screen.

Best Practices for Managing 3RT841B Firmware in Your Plant
Proactive management beats reactive firefighting. Implement these four best practices:
- Maintain a firmware register – Spreadsheet or asset management database listing each 3RT841B’s serial number, current firmware, and last update date.
- Test before mass deployment – Set up one test contactor on a bench with the same PLC type and network conditions. Run it for 48 hours.
- Keep offline copies – Download every firmware version you ever use (including obsolete ones). Siemens occasionally removes very old versions from public servers.
- Schedule updates during planned outages – Do not update just because a new version exists. Only update to fix a specific problem or to meet a new requirement. If it works, document and wait.

Recovery steps (if update fails / bricked)
- Soft reset: Hold reset button per manual (5–10s) to restore defaults.
- Bootloader/Recovery mode: Enter by specific button sequence or serial console; re-flash via USB/serial tool.
- Serial logs: Connect via TTL serial to view boot messages for errors.
- Use manufacturer recovery tool or contact support if available.
